As you know and Paul pointed out, Octalink is Shimano’s trademarked bottom bracket spline pattern. It features 8 splines and is Shimano proprietary. In other words, only Shimano cranks or those manufactered under Shimano license can employ the Octalink pattern spline.
ISIS is another pattern which features 10 splines and was introduced as an attempt by independant, non-Shimano component manufacturers to create an alternate industry standard.
In general, there are a greater selection of cranks from a wider variety of manufacturers in the ISIS pattern since manufacturers are not tied to Shimano and their manufacturing licenses.
While the technical merits of each can be argued ad nauseum, the two are roughly comparable mechanically. The greater versatility of ISIS provides some degree of appeal, to include the introduction of certain frames with integrated bottom brackets using greatly oversized bottom brackets and bearings but a spindle with the ISIS pattern, not unlike Cannondale’s excellent Hollogram design which is Cannondale’s own proprietary pattern. Also, in general, Octalink BB spindles measure 109.5 mm wide while most ISIS are 108 mm wide. This usually does not affect fit or “Q” factor from our experience.
Square spindles are still an excellent design employing a much narrower spindle in favour of larger diameter ball bearing on non-sealed cartridge units. The majority of elite track sprinters continue to use square taper bottom bracket spindles due to the ability to run 1/4" ball bearing in their bottom brackets. They believe the benefit is lower bearing resistance and greater durability as well as a high degree of maintainability (but a high need for maintenance also). I use a square bottom bracket in my road bike and prefer it. It seems easier to get a crank squarely mounted with a square taper than with a splined design, with less chance of damage on installation.
Your bike uses an English thread BB shell that is 68 mm wide. Always check your crank manufacturer’s recommendation for spindle width. Accept their recommendation. Also, be mindful of torque specs when installing cranks and be certain to check the torque of your chainring bolts, especially a few weeks after initial installation.
